You must also configure an IP address for the video processing module. The IP
address of the video processing module must be different than the IP address
configured for the LifeSize Multipoint unit.
Initial monitoring and administration of the video processing module are
performed from a remote PC using a terminal emulation application, such as
HyperTerminal. To make the serial connection, connect a PC terminal to the
lower serial port on the front panel of the LifeSize Multipoint unit as described
in
on page 14. The serial configuration utility runs as a
target configuration service. You can use the serial configuration utility to:
Configure default network port values.
Modify the configuration software password.
Modify the LifeSize Multipoint unit IP address.
Modify advanced configuration settings such as the web server port
and LAN port, and to restore the factory configuration.
